This 2014 Can-Am Commander 800 XT was brought in because it was lurching really bad when the clutch engaged. Owner uses it on their property/farm towing spreaders and feed trailers etc. So they are often going at slow speeds (under 10mph sometimes even closer to ). The machine had (if I remember correctly) roughly @1500 miles on it. As you can see in the pictures the clutches have seen some better days. Now in fairness, it was not always primarily used this way but a lot of what you see is from driving in high gear and really should have been in low range. The belt was rarely traveling up the primary. Can't see it in photos but there was minimal belt "dust" on the primary past where you can see the extreme wear. Some on the secondary, minimal wear closer to the center. This generation of Can-Am machines (Commanders, Mavericks) are known for belt breakage issues and over heating of belts to begin with mainly due to the overall design they have. Take that and add in wrong gear selection and this is what you'll end up with.
So, clearly the inner sheave of the primary needed replacement. The one-way bearing assembly also needed to be replaced. You'll also see in the photos that the rollers flat spotted pretty bad as well, so they needed to get swapped out too. The secondary sheaves were in good shape overall but the torque ring gear was worn quite a bit and had some small cracks so replaced that as well. All Balls Racing one-way bearing kit took care of the primary and also a replacement air filter, EPI Performance primary roller kit solved the flat spotted rollers in the primary, engine/differentials/transmission got Maxima Racing Oils for all their lubrication needs and Hunterworks Inc. belt connecting the clutches together got this machine running efficiently and smoothly again. Now clutch engagement is super smooth and it's easy to hold machine at a slow speed in low range without it surging or lurching.
